vyuka:cviceni:y36sps:zadani-openvpn-lab

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
vyuka:cviceni:y36sps:zadani-openvpn-lab [2010/03/31 07:38] rootvyuka:cviceni:y36sps:zadani-openvpn-lab [2020/04/14 17:25] (current) – [Per-client konfigurace] kubr
Line 5: Line 5:
   - zvolte si právě jednoho kamaráda s PC   - zvolte si právě jednoho kamaráda s PC
   - na svém PC nakonfigurujte rozhraní dummy0 s IP adresou 1.2.X.10/24, kde X je poslední oktet IP adresy vašeho PC   - na svém PC nakonfigurujte rozhraní dummy0 s IP adresou 1.2.X.10/24, kde X je poslední oktet IP adresy vašeho PC
-  - zprovozněte spojení prostřednictvím openvpn mezi vašimi dvěmi PC+  - zprovozněte spojení prostřednictvím openvpn mezi vašimi dvěma PC
   - na konci si budete pingat z obou PC navzájem na rozhraní dummy0 na druhém PC   - na konci si budete pingat z obou PC navzájem na rozhraní dummy0 na druhém PC
   - na každém PC poběží 1x OpenVPN server a 1x OpenVPN klient. Po připojení do VPN se klientovi automaticky nastaví správná cesta (route)   - na každém PC poběží 1x OpenVPN server a 1x OpenVPN klient. Po připojení do VPN se klientovi automaticky nastaví správná cesta (route)
Line 28: Line 28:
  
 ===== Nápověda ===== ===== Nápověda =====
 +
 +  * {{:vyuka:cviceni:y36sps:openvpn.pdf|Situace - PDF}}
 +  * {{:vyuka:cviceni:y36sps:openvpn.odp|Situace - ODP (OpenOffice, s "animací")}}
 +
 +==== Dummy interface ====
 +
 +dummy0 je virtuální rozhraní, které fyzicky není, ale lokálně jich můžete vytvořit neomezený počet a každému dát ip adresu.
 +
 +V Debianu (ubuntu) je nutné nahrát do jádra modul:
 +
 +<code bash>
 +modprobe dummy
 +</code>
 +
 +A pak už jen konfigurovat ipčka, např.
 +
 +<code bash>
 +ifconfig dummy0 1.2.3.4 netmask 255.255.255.0 
 +</code>
  
 ==== Instalace ==== ==== Instalace ====
Line 194: Line 213:
 push "redirect-gateway" push "redirect-gateway"
 </file> </file>
 +
 +==== Další zdroje ====
  
   * Další detaily k možnostem konfigurace OpenVPN naleznete v oficiálním HOWTO: http://openvpn.net/index.php/open-source/documentation/howto.html   * Další detaily k možnostem konfigurace OpenVPN naleznete v oficiálním HOWTO: http://openvpn.net/index.php/open-source/documentation/howto.html
 +  * [[https://www.root.cz/clanky/openvpn-vpn-jednoduse/|OpenVPN – VPN jednoduše (Radek Hladík)]]
 +  * [[https://www.root.cz/clanky/nasazujeme-openvpn-snadno-a-rychle-navod/|Nasazujeme OpenVPN snadno a rychle (Petr Krčmář)]]
 +  * [[https://www.root.cz/clanky/openvpn-pro-mirne-pokrocile/|OpenVPN pro mírně pokročilé (Dan Ohnesorg)]]
 +  * [[https://www.root.cz/zpravicky/jak-na-openvpn-server/|Jak na OpenVPN server (Jan Fikar)]]
 +  * [[https://www.youtube.com/watch?v=uUbgt9FLrvk|LinuxDays 2016 - Tinc VPN - jak snadno najít toho pravého (Michal Halenka)]]
 +  * [[https://www.youtube.com/watch?v=xebLlFG2XlY|WireGuard (Jan Baier)]]
 +  * [[https://www.youtube.com/watch?v=KZC_XcG4lmo|LinuxDays 2017 - IPv6 tunely pomocí OpenVPN (Ondřej Caletka)]]
  • vyuka/cviceni/y36sps/zadani-openvpn-lab.1270021086.txt.gz
  • Last modified: 2010/03/31 07:38
  • by root